Two Charged in North Side Shooting
LETHBRIDGE: Two men have been charged and Lethbridge Police are looking for a third, in connection with a drug related shooting early Tuesday morning on the north side.
The shooting happened around 2:30-am on March 15, in the alley behind Gonzo’s Gas along the 900 block of 9 Avenue North. An investigation found that a 26-year-old woman and 30-year-old man were in the alley, when they were shot at by subjects in a vehicle, who then fled the scene. Neither of the victims was injured.
Police have noted that it was a targeted incident related to the drug trade, and that everyone involved was known to one another.
The investigation resulted in a search warrant being executed March 15 at 8-pm at a home along Mount Sundance Crescent, in which two men were taken into custody. Police also seized 170 grams of Fentanyl, nearly 20 grams of cocaine, 26.5 grams of crack cocaine, nearly $5,000 in cash and two vehicles.
